Hm, I know Russian letters and can mostly read the phonetics, so unless there is a grammatical annexion rule where the ending of a name becomes 'i' just to indicate possession but actually gets pronounced 'off', then no, that does read litterally 'volki monastir'. If it was Volkov, it would have ended as "овы" or "ов", not и, i.
I wikipedia'd my way to the translation, so I'd trust Kai-V's judgement over mine, just sayin'. I know zero Russian.
The и in волки is the nominative plural declension of волк (and actually a ы morphed by the к), which means wolf. It reads, as Kai-V said, 'Volki'. The genitive plural, interestingly, would actually be волков--'volkov'--but would have to be placed after Монастырь (nominative singular) to mean that it was the Wolves' Monastery. Волков as a name would have a different declension of which the nominative plural would indeed be -ы as Kai-V stated.

As it stands, it is Wolves Monastery, but as far as I know--and I arguably know very little--it doesn't really mean anything, as I don't know of two nominatives stacking together that way.

As for -ov/-off, voiced consonants in the final position tend to become unvoiced in Russian (v sounds like f, d like t, etc.). Therefore, 'Zangief' in your subtitles is most likely 'Zangiev'.
